Dubai’s scorching sun can take a toll on your car’s interior, causing discomfort and damage. The intense heat and UV rays can lead to faded upholstery, cracked dashboards, and overheated cabin temperatures. To keep your car’s interior cool and protected, it’s essential to implement effective strategies. In this article, we will provide you with valuable Tips for Keeping Your Car’s Interior Cool and Protected from Dubai’s Sun, ensuring a comfortable and well-maintained interior.

1. Park in Shaded Areas

One of the simplest and most effective ways to keep your car’s interior cool is to park in shaded areas whenever possible. Look for covered parking lots, underground parking garages, or use car shades to protect your vehicle from direct sunlight. Parking in the shade helps reduce the temperature inside the car and minimizes the risk of heat-related damage.

2. Use Windshield Sun Shades

Windshield sun shades are an excellent investment to protect your car’s interior from the sun’s heat and UV rays. These shades are designed to fit across the windshield, blocking the direct sunlight and reducing the heat buildup in the cabin. When parking your car, unfold the sun shade and place it against the windshield to keep the interior cooler.

3. Tint Your Windows

Window tinting is a popular solution in Dubai to combat the intense sun. It helps reduce the amount of heat entering the car, blocks harmful UV rays, and provides privacy. Consult a professional tinting service to ensure compliance with local regulations and choose a tint that offers both heat and UV protection.

4. Invest in Seat Covers

Seat covers not only protect your seats from wear and tear but also help keep them cool. Opt for seat covers made from materials that are breathable and heat-resistant, such as mesh or cool fabric. These covers create a barrier between the sun and the seats, preventing them from absorbing excessive heat.

5. Apply UV Protectant

To prevent fading, cracking, and discoloration of your car’s interior surfaces, apply a high-quality UV protectant. These protectants act as a barrier against harmful UV rays and help maintain the appearance and integrity of your dashboard, door panels, and other surfaces. Follow the product instructions for proper application and reapplication.

6. Regularly Clean and Condition

Proper cleaning and conditioning of your car’s interior can also contribute to its protection from the sun. Regularly vacuum the upholstery and use a suitable cleaner to remove dust, dirt, and stains. Additionally, apply a conditioner specifically formulated for the type of material in your car’s interior to keep it hydrated and prevent drying and cracking.

7. Consider Window Visors

Window visors, also known as rain guards, not only deflect rain but also provide shade for your car’s windows. These visors allow you to keep your windows slightly open during hot days, promoting air circulation and reducing the buildup of heat inside the cabin. Install window visors that are compatible with your car’s make and model.
